{"id":17055021,"url":"https://github.com/ziguzagu/plack-middleware-defaultdocument","last_synced_at":"2025-03-23T06:12:34.639Z","repository":{"id":7279312,"uuid":"8593541","full_name":"ziguzagu/Plack-Middleware-DefaultDocument","owner":"ziguzagu","description":"Return default document with '200' instead of '404' error","archived":false,"fork":false,"pushed_at":"2013-03-12T08:47:00.000Z","size":144,"stargazers_count":0,"open_issues_count":1,"forks_count":0,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-03-15T01:47:20.954Z","etag":null,"topics":["cpan","perl","plack"],"latest_commit_sha":null,"homepage":null,"language":"Perl","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/ziguzagu.png","metadata":{"files":{"readme":"README","changelog":"Changes","cont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2013-03-06T01:42:48.000Z","updated_at":"2020-02-06T10:49:33.000Z","dependencies_parsed_at":"2022-09-02T05:22:31.419Z","dependency_job_id":null,"html_url":"https://github.com/ziguzagu/Plack-Middleware-DefaultDocument","commit_stats":null,"previous_names":[],"tags_count":2,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ziguzagu%2FPlack-Middleware-DefaultDocument","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ziguzagu%2FPlack-Middleware-DefaultDocument/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ziguzagu%2FPlack-Middleware-DefaultDocument/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ziguzagu%2FPlack-Middleware-DefaultDocument/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/ziguzagu","download_url":"https://codeload.github.com/ziguzagu/Plack-Middleware-DefaultDocument/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":245061390,"owners_count":20554563,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["cpan","perl","plack"],"created_at":"2024-10-14T10:16:28.880Z","updated_at":"2025-03-23T06:12:34.618Z","avatar_url":"https://github.com/ziguzagu.png","language":"Perl","funding_links":[],"categories":[],"sub_categories":[],"readme":"NAME\n    Plack::Middleware::DefaultDocument - Return default document with '200'\n    instead of '404' error\n\nSYNOPSIS\n      enable \"DefaultDocument\" =\u003e (\n          '/favicon\\.ico$' =\u003e '/path/to/htodcs/favicon.ico',\n          '/robots\\.txt'   =\u003e '/path/to/htdocs/robots.txt',\n      );\n\nDESCRIPTION\n    This DefaultDocument middleware is able to return '200' response with\n    default document instead of '404' error. It is useful in the case that\n    your application can't find any contents from database, assets of users,\n    static assets and etc, but has system default file for request URL and\n    to want to return it with '200' reponse, not '404' errror.\n\nSEE ALSO\n    Plack::Middleware::ErrorDocument\n\nAUTHOR\n    Hiroshi Sakai \u003cziguzagu@cpan.org\u003e\n\nLICENSE\n    This library is free software; you can redistribute it and/or modify it\n    under the same terms as Perl itself.\n\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fziguzagu%2Fplack-middleware-defaultdocument","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fziguzagu%2Fplack-middleware-defaultdocument","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fziguzagu%2Fplack-middleware-defaultdocument/lists"}